Move to Annual Billing — Managers Only. For Soleta Works sales leads. From next quarter, new Pindrop contracts default to annual billing; monthly remains by exception only, with director approval. Renewals convert at anniversary. Talking points and discount guidance are on the pricing page. The confidential rationale tied to our wider plans follows below.

management briefing: The renewal with Druixox Group closes at $20 million a year, 10 percent below the last contract. Project Zorath slips by six weeks because of the tooling delay.

Subject: Key rotation — Fabrikit test-data factory

Heads up. The Fabrikit library's access to the Mockwell seed service rotates tonight. Old keys die at 18:00. Update your local env before running any factory builds tomorrow, or fixtures will fail to generate. No code changes needed, just swap the credential. The new key follows below.

service key, fawip-bajef: kto11_Qt5wZK9vdNC

## Proctor Queue: Getting Unstuck

Welcome aboard! The ExamWarden proctoring queue backs up when the snapshot service hiccups. First, check the GlanceBoard panel for consumer lag. If lag exceeds 10k, restart the vetting workers with the `requeue-soft` flag — don't hard-drain, you'll lose session flags. Escalate to the Lanternfish team if lag persists past 20 minutes. To query the queue admin endpoint directly, authenticate with the internal key below.

app token of tagef-tafog = qvz3-7n0

Title: SpokeShift rebalancer keeps losing its DB connection

Flagging for the weekly sync: the SpokeShift rebalancing tool has been dropping its database connection a few times a day since Tuesday, usually mid-optimization, so dock assignments come out half-written. Pool settings look sane and the DB itself is healthy. If anyone wants to reproduce before Thursday, connect using the string below.

replica DSN, kajep-yahag: mssql://praok_svc:iF@db-8d68.plorvaio.local:5432/eliion